Step 1

The key to the It-Girl makeup look is a flawless yet natural complexion. Opt for a lightweight foundation like Maybelline SuperStay 24H Skin Tint to achieve bright, skin-like coverage. Use a damp beauty blender to seamlessly blend the foundation into your skin for that natural finish. Beauty blenders are key for achieving that weightless, natural look. The damp texture of the beauty blender helps to eliminate any harsh lines or streaks and leaves behind a flawless, airbrushed finish.

Step 2

Brightening the undereyes and concealing any imperfections is essential for achieving that fresh-faced appearance. With a Maybelline Instant Age Rewind Concealer that’s a few shades lighter than your foundation, use the same damp beauty blender to apply the concealer, ensuring it blends seamlessly into your skin. For blemishes or pigmentation, opt for a concealer that matches your foundation shade for extra coverage and apply as needed.

Step 3

The iconic doe-eye look was a staple of early 2000s makeup looks, and recreating it is key to nailing this aesthetic. Using a slightly darker brown shade of the Maybelline Color Tattoo Eye Stix, trace the bottom of your lower lash line. This will create the appearance of a shadow and make your eyes look bigger and more round. Then, by adding a touch of shimmer to your tear ducts and brow bone with an Eye Stix in the shade I am Courageous, your eyes will be brightened and lifted, giving you that signature frosty Y2K sparkle.

Step 4

No matter the look you were going for, pencil eyeliner was every 2000s girl’s best friend! Using a Maybelline Tattoo Studio Sharpenable Eyeliner in the shade Bold Brown, create a classic wing that elongates and defines your eyes. To add a touch of drama, extend the liner along the outer third of your bottom lash line. Apply a few coats of Maybelline Lash Sensational Sky High Mascara in the shade True Brown for lengthening and volumizing impact from every angle. Finally, fill in any sparse areas of your brows with the Build-A-Brow 2-in-1 Brow Pen and Sealing Gel. Use gentle strokes that follow the natural direction of your brow hairs and then seal the look in place for up to 24 hours with the clear gel.

Step 5

In the era of 2000 It-Girls, contouring took a backseat to blush, and for good reason. A pop of pink on the cheeks adds a youthful, rosy glow that complements the natural base beautifully. Applying Maybelline Cheek Heat Gel-Cream Blush to the apples of your cheeks and blending upwards not only adds color but also enhances your bone structure.

Step 6

No 2000 makeup look would be complete without a touch of pink on the lips. Maybelline Lifter Plump lip plumper gloss in the shade Pink Sting provides a natural yet vibrant burst of color that ties the whole look together.

Step 7

To give the look that truly natural and clean finish, use the Build-A-Brow 2-in-1 Pen to dot some freckles across your face for that natural finishing touch.
